IÉSEG Bootcamp: a step into professional life
The Corporate Relations Department at IÉSEG, in collaboration with IÉSEG Network (the alumni association), organized a dedicated bootcamp for international students enrolled in its postgraduate programs. Held on the Lille and Paris-La Défense campuses at the end of May, the event symbolically marked students’ transition into the professional world, supporting them as they move from student life to their future careers.
Nearly 300 students took part in this highly anticipated milestone event. The program included a soft skills–based escape game, an improvisational theater session, and a keynote speech by IÉSEG’s Dean, Caroline Roussel, followed by a convivial cocktail reception with IÉSEG alumni.
The escape game: an immersive way to put soft skills into action
Students had 45 minutes to solve a series of puzzles in teams, drawing on both collective intelligence and skills they developed throughout their studies: information gathering, adaptability, problem-solving, critical thinking, and communication. Acting as members of a government task force, their mission was to analyze clues provided by AI to track down hackers responsible for a cyberattack and identify the location of their headquarters.

“The goal was to give students the opportunity to test the soft skills they have developed during their time at IÉSEG—and, more importantly, to immerse them in a type of exercise increasingly used in recruitment processes. Beyond traditional interviews, recruiters like to observe candidates in action and in authentic situations, often through formats such as escape games,” explains Roseline ANDAN, International Programs Career Manager at IÉSEG and co-organizer of the 2025 Bootcamp.

Winners of the escape game were rewarded with a selection of artisanal French products from Payzan and Les Exploratrices, two brands created by IÉSEG alumni.
IÉSEG Network: the next step for students
Through a series of lively sketches blending music, dance, drawing, and humor, students were introduced to the many services of IÉSEG Network, which they join upon graduation. These services include coaching, mentoring, international clubs, entrepreneurial support, and much more. Alumni also joined the performance to share their own career journeys, alongside the IÉSEG Network team. This original and dynamic format highlighted the breadth of opportunities available to graduates and encouraged students to remain actively engaged with the community.
